Output 74cc297389b81a5f4d0cc5f37ed7147b591952a3516011a86c16ae5821ad6c1f:27

value
59452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3534515774e1a9c24dc1801f93bcd01cc6875eda OP_EQUAL
address
36YLQozrqQBVBKC6wescxHP5VkQo2wy5eJ
transaction
74cc297389b81a5f4d0cc5f37ed7147b591952a3516011a86c16ae5821ad6c1f
spent
true